The Grand Tour of Italy
Join us as we travel through the very different and fabulous wine regions of Italy. We will taste some of the myriad of indigenous grapes that make Italian wine so different and intriguing including - Nebbiolo (Barolo), Sangiovese (Chianti), Corvina (Valpolicella), and Barbera.
Italy can be the most confusing wine country to get to know, with its enormous diversity of wine styles, often from the same town! It is, however, worth spending a little time to understand it, with the discoveries amply repaying the effort involved. We will wander through the north of the country, from the NW (Piedmont) to the NE (Veneto), through Tuscany and the Marches to the warm south (Puglia, Campania, & Sicily).
You will experience, first hand, the amazing range of grape varieties and flavours that Italy has to offer. You will taste some classic Italian wines, along with some new- wave wines from really cutting-edge winemakers.
